Range Cooker Dual Fuel - A Kitchen Powerhouse
Range cooker dual fuel is an elegant kitchen appliance that blends electric oven and gas cooking. These cookers are equipped with a variety of safety features, including flame failure devices as well as automatic shut-off valves for gas hobs.
They are usually more expensive than those that use only electricity or gas. However they can bring value to a house and help cooks feel confident.
Versatility
A dual fuel range is a kitchen powerhouse that combines the dependable warmth of gas flames with the constant heating of electric ovens. This combination permits both professional and amateur chefs to create delicious meals. The gas burners can be used to cook peppers and cook tortillas while the electric heating in the oven allows for quick temperature adjustments and optimal heat distribution.
A range cooker dual fuel is a great option for those who wish to try out new cooking techniques. For example, you can experiment with searing a filet or grilling vegetables on the stovetop, while using the oven to bake. Dual fuel ranges are flexible and can be used in any kitchen design or cooking style.
The best dual fuel range for your home is based on many aspects, including your preferences for cooking and your budget. The best way to start is by evaluating your cooking habits and evaluating the types of dishes you prepare frequently. Think about the layout of your kitchen and how many burners are needed. You can also choose from a range of colors, and modify features to fit your style.
Professional ranges are made from top-quality materials, and they have a sleek and sleek appearance. They can enhance the look of your kitchen. These ranges are typically constructed with durable, tough elements that are influenced by commercial designs. They also have huge capacities, which makes them perfect for roasts that are large or baking tray. These ranges are usually made of stainless steel, which improves the durability and luster.
There are a wide range of sizes to choose from 30-inch models to 60-inch ovens. The size of your kitchen and the number of people you cook for will decide which one is suitable for you. Consider how much storage you have, as it could impact your cooking process. The most important thing is to choose the right range for your needs. The ideal dual-fuel range will provide you with the functionality you require and match your style.
Safety
A gas hob and an electric oven is a great option to have more flexibility when cooking. The gas stove allows you to quickly alter the temperature, and the electric oven ensures an even heating. This prevents your food from being overcooked or burning. The top dual-fuel range dual fuel cooker cookers have numerous safety features, including flame failure devices and automatic shut-off valves. These features can reduce the risk of fires as well as other injuries.
A dual-fuel range also has an additional benefit: it is easy cleaning. The burner heads and grates are usually sealed or constructed of enamel-coated cast iron, which makes them easy to wipe clean. A lot of models come with self-cleaning function that utilizes high temperatures to melt away food remnants and stains. Some models come with an oven rack which can be cleaned in the dishwasher.
Dual-duel fuel cooker ranges are more expensive than those that only use gas but they come with many features that make them worth the cost. Some of them include an oven that is large, a grill and storage drawers. The gas burners that are included in these ranges can be set to a maximum of 18,000 Btu that is enough to cook most foods. The oven's temperature can be lowered for baking or roasting.
A popular option for dual-fuel ranges is the GE Monogram line. This range comes in a variety of sizes, including 30 and 48-inch models, each with one or more ovens. The oven has a capacity of up to 6.6 cubic feet. The gas burners can be adjusted to an maximum of 18,000 Btu. They are also able to be lowered to a level that will melt the butter without browning. Contrary to other brands, Monogram does not offer an induction model or a built-in microwave.
The installation of a dual-fuel stove is a complex procedure that requires a licensed electrician. The installer will check the connections to the electrical and gas lines and the location of the stove's gas valve. The installer can then ensure that the appliance is safe, and that it is compliant with local regulations. It is crucial to choose an experienced and qualified installer, since an improper installation could lead to gas leaks and other dangers.
Convenience
Dual fuel range cookers are the ideal option for cooks that want versatility, convenience and style in their kitchen appliances. These ranges combine the powerful control of gas stoves along with the convenient and consistent cooking performance of electric Ovens.
They are perfect for cooks of all levels of experience and age starting from novice home chefs to professional chefs. They are available in a range of sizes that can accommodate multiple gas burners and ovens. This lets you cook anything from gourmet meals to large family roasts.
Leisure's dual-fuel range cookers are equipped with cutting-edge technology that produces precise cooking results. They also provide outstanding flexibility. Patented dual-stacked, sealed gas burners offer fast and precise high-to low temperature control, and spark ignition systems that ignite automatically. Dual VertiFlow's convection technology in the electric oven reduces hot and cool spots to ensure even cooking on a variety of racks. Other useful features include telescopic oven shelves, cast iron pan supports, wok burners, and modern oven timers.
Our premium range cookers include an air fryer that is built-in and advanced features that make cooking easy. You can use an air fryer, as an example, to cook healthier meals using less oil by using a preset that automatically adjusts the heat level and cooking times. Another convenient feature is the auto-cleaning mode, which removes oil residue and grit from your oven.
